London town, Mayfair, cocktails, a beautiful lady, Playboy bunnies and it’s my birthday. It all takes you back to London in the swinging 60’s. Playboy is one of those great American institutions and the story of Playboy is real insight into American culture. For many years there had not been a Playboy club in London but earlier on this year they reopened at 14 Old Park Lane. Housed in a what looks like a 60’s building you are surrounded by the great London hotels.

Greated by suited doorman we were escorted into Salvatore’s, the cocktail bar named after renowned mixologist and cocktail expert Salvatore Calabrese who has personally researched the history of traditional cocktails from as far back as the 16th  century.

We arrived quite early so the bar was relaxed but friendly. I was particularly impressed by the knowledgeable barman. From an interiors perspective the look embodies the history of Playboy with a mixture of Arabian and some inspiration from the 60’s.

After a relaxing drink we moved onto the restaurant upstairs which also houses the casino, the smoking room, Gentlemans Tonic and another bar. The restaurant area is furnished in what may be termed modern dining.

We both had seafood starters which were excellent, tasty and well presented.

The main course had to be the specially raised beef “Wagyu NY Strip” with a mixture of side dishes. Though highly original they differ quite a lot from standard British taste, which is just to say expect it creamy. Finally onto an desert which was straight out of the film “Grease” American Cheese Cake and Vanilla Ice Cream Sundae.

Next to us were some business clients and Arabic gentlemen, all of whom seemed to be both friendly and at ease as it was home from home for them.

Arrived about 9pm, left just before 2am at which time The Cottontail Lounge was alive with people dancing. What I really liked about my evening was that it was different, in a good way, to many other evenings on offer in London and to leave well fed, relaxed and happy must be a good thing,

I recently visited Grosvenor House, A JW Marriott Hotel, located on London’s Park Lane in the heart of Mayfair. Interestingly I have a family connection, as I believe my god father was the hotel manager probably back in the 1970’s. Though it first opened in 1929, the hotel has been a frequent home to royalty, and other distinguished guests, so I fit in perfectly ! Renovated in 2009 it is spacious, very central and in my opinion a perfect place for a business meeting, meeting an old friend and certainly excellent for anyone who likes a hearty meal.

I am not sure I know a gentleman who does not like a good steak and I am no exception.

I arrived at 8 for Dinner and was greeted by a friendly welcome, and whilst waiting for my friend to arrive sat and had a drink in The Bourbon Bar.

The décor certainly reminds me of the US, tall ceilings, plenty of room, smart but casual and very easy going, a perfect environment to have a catch up and a good conversation.

We plumbed for a three couse meal, crab soups & crab cakes, 2 different Steaks, Aberdeen Angus, and myself the signature steak, a dramatic 32 ounce, on-the-bone rib eye aptly named ‘The Tomahawk.’, certainly good for any aspiring Rugby player.

I asked for a recommendation on the wine and was not disappointed as the red, matched perfectly with my steak.

Afterwards we shared a cheesecake, coffee and sat and talked with no feeling of time.

Having probably been sat for just over 3 hours we left at just past midnight, dropping into their red bar for a cheeky cocktail then home, one of us heading north and the other south.

If you are looking for smart and friendly with solid tasty food where you can talk and relax then this is for you. Perfect to take any American friends or clients who are missing home or for American events such as Independence Day and Thanksgiving.
